106514113225 has 27 divisors (see below), whose sum is σ = 143047321599. Its totient is φ = 78640910400.
The previous prime is 106514113217. The next prime is 106514113231. The reversal of 106514113225 is 522311415601.
The square root of 106514113225 is 326365.
It is a perfect power (a square), and thus also a powerful number.
It can be written as a sum of positive squares in 13 ways, for example, as 59510138809 + 47003974416 = 243947^2 + 216804^2 .
It is not a de Polignac number, because 106514113225 - 23 = 106514113217 is a prime.
It is a super-2 number, since 2×1065141132252 (a number of 23 digits) contains 22 as substring.
It is an unprimeable number.
It is a polite number, since it can be written in 26 ways as a sum of consecutive naturals, for example, 21211215 + ... + 21216235.
Almost surely, 2106514113225 is an apocalyptic number.
106514113225 is the 326365-th square number.
106514113225 is the 163183-rd centered octagonal number.
It is an amenable number.
106514113225 is a deficient number, since it is larger than the sum of its proper divisors (36533208374).
106514113225 is an frugal number, since it uses more digits than its factorization.
106514113225 is an evil number, because the sum of its binary digits is even.
The sum of its prime factors is 10078 (or 5039 counting only the distinct ones).
The product of its (nonzero) digits is 7200, while the sum is 31.
Adding to 106514113225 its reverse (522311415601), we get a palindrome (628825528826).
